TarBoarders interested in immersing themselves in the events which were
happening around the time AR was writing SA may be interested in the essay
on Colonel Percy Fawcett recently reposted on If Not Duffers... . Was Colonel
Fawcett - with his Amazonian expeditions, explorations and search for lost
gold mines - an influence on AR's creation of SA? Was he, in part perhaps,
an inspiration for the character of the restless James Turner?
